Looking for constructive feedback - not really clicking with my Leica M4-P by Xeivia in AnalogCommunity

[–]Luoric 1 point2 points  (0 children)

I started my rangefinder journey with the leica M3 and a shoe mounted meter, also ran into some issues that you faced. The shoe meter just gives a general reading of the scene, in high contrast situations how you set your exposure depends on what you want to be exposed, relying on a 50degree reflective meter might lead to under/overexposure if you’re not taking into account what the scene looks like and what you want to be exposed.

I was able to pickup a sekonic spot meter, while clunky it helped me to understand exposure better especially with the zone system and how I wanted to expose my scenes. I shoot mainly with a M6 now which uses a center weighted metering approach, so I just point it around the scene to get a rough idea of the exposure.

As for the focusing, I understand where you’re coming from. For me i always felt that i had to perfectly align the rangefinder patch everytime i took a photo, which leads to me fiddling back and forth a bunch. But unless you’re always shooting wide open, theres no need to be 100% aligned. you could be 90% at f/8 and it will still come out sharp, or heck you could try zone focusing.

What's better for 28mm? by Fine_Calligrapher584 in Leica

[–]Luoric 8 points9 points  (0 children)

haven’t tried the zeiss but have a .58. Its much btr than the .72 finder for 28mm. I wear glasses and can see the whole 28mm framelines. If you can pick up a M6TTL/M7/MP with a .58 its well worth it.

Keep it mind that it gets harder to focus at wider apertures. I struggle to focus with my 50 1.2, anything below F/2 is fine though.

Why does this keep happening with my 500 C/M by LongRanger_6-5 in hasselblad

[–]Luoric 0 points1 point  (0 children)

likely to be the issue, had the same problem w my A16, but my light leak is at the left edge. You can double check this by 1. taking off the lens 2. removing dark slide 3. mirror lockup 4. shine a light through the darkslide slot and see if theres any light in the body

the light leak only appears on mine when I leave my darkslide out for a prolonged period of time.

you prob need to replace the seals

Some advice needed. Thanks! by TheAdventurousSci in Leica

[–]Luoric 3 points4 points  (0 children)

film is a whole new rabbit hole, and to get the most out of your negatives you need to develop your workflow (development scanning editing) which could take months to get it to where you get images you’re happy with. which is why some people are dissatisfied with their images when the first make the jump, where all they get back is green casted noritsu scans with poor dynamic range. Something to keep in mind.

but if you’re willing to put in the time, my votes on the M6

Leica M4 or MA? by thejpgchef in Leica

[–]Luoric 2 points3 points  (0 children)

which 35mm did you get? Both M4 and M2 are fantastic cameras. I wont belabour the points on servicing, its up to your preference. One thing to note is the MA has 28mm framelines and a hotshoe. These 2 will be dealbreakers for me as I shoot mainly 28mm and use a flash from time to time, ofc PC sync and external finders exist but they make the setup more bulky.

Why not consider a M-P? they’re priced similarly to the M-A and you can always remove the battery.

As for the built in meter, it depends on how proficient you are at judging light. Most people love leica Ms for the speed and ease of use, so if you find yourself having to fiddle around to adjust your exposure, youre better off having a meter. Anecdotally speaking, I first had a M3, and I come from digital so Im not great at judging light and had to rely on a meter. It took me super long to shoot every frame because I was constantly adjusting and metering. I then got a M6TTL and for me it was lifechanging, i just point the camera and shoot, the meter makes it so much easier and I can focus on getting the picture
